@Brianp81  - the two errors that are being corrected the most (by far) by the IRS are the Recovery Rebate Credit (line 30) and the Advance Child Tax Credit (line 28) of Form 1040. 

 

If you've been doing taxes for 40 years, I'll assume the issue is Line 30.

 

During the TT interview process, you were asked how much you received for the THIRD stimulus (received March - May, 2021).  If your response did not match the IRS records, the IRS adjusted Line 30.

 

What made this more complex is that the IRS send out a letter to each taxpayer confirming how much stimulus they received.  But if you filed joint, there were TWO letters, one addressed to each spouse, with half the money on each letter.  In TT, you needed to ADD the amounts of the two letters together.  If you didn't, then Line 30 was inflated, which inflated the refund and the IRS caught that error.
